Meet blaze

Blaze is very energetic and likes to start play fights with his siblings. He loves going outside and also uses the wee wee pad for potty. He doesn't like to use the same pad more than once so he will use the floor right by the pad. He barks at the mop and broom. He has had his puppy shots and deworming, just needs his rabies shot and his big puppy shots. He does well with children and other people. He does bark at other dogs. He loves to dig. He is not as aggressive with chewing as his siblings.
